Форум 1С
Программистам, бухгалтерам, администраторам, пользователям
Задай вопрос - получи решение проблемы
22 ноя 2024, 12:14

Отчет СКД по месяцам и датам

Автор dashae, 10 мая 2020, 23:55

0 Пользователей и 1 гость просматривают эту тему.

dashae

Добрый вечер! Есть регистр накопления "ПланыПроведенияОтбораПроб", по которому надо сформировать план, по которому проводятся работы. В нем есть измерения: "Показатель", "ТочкаОтбора", "Площадка", "ДатаПроведения" и ресурс "ОбъемПробы".
Необходимо вывести такой отчет по месяцам, а в месяце с разбивкой по конкретным датам, в которые будут проводиться работы.
Уже много всего перепробовала, но выходит какой-то ужас. Отчеты такие еще ни разу не делала. Помогите, пожалуйста.
В качестве примера ориентируюсь на данный отчет (но вместо дохода и расхода должны быть как раз даты, а вместо сумм - объем проб).

и еще вопрос, возможно ли чтобы в ячейках, был не ресурс, а как раз-таки дата?

LexaK

просто в свой запрос добавьте еще одну колонку Месяц
так, пример

Выбрать
    ...
    ВашРегистр.ДатаПроведения,
    НАЧАЛОПЕРИОДА(ВашРегистр.ДатаПроведения, Месяц) как Месяц,
    ...

к вашим полям
"Площадка", "ДатаПроведения" и ресурс "ОбъемПробы".
и группировки по строкам делаете по месяцу
Строки
    Месяц
        ДетальныеЗаписи
в детальных записях
    "ДатаПроведения" и ресурс "ОбъемПробы".

да и сортировку по "ДатаПроведения" включите обязательно
(возможно оптимальнее сделать вертикальное расположение групп вместо горизонтальной (как на примере)
оформите ваш отчет как внешний, присоедините  к теме, будет гораздо легче давть советы/примеры
если помогло нажмите: Спасибо!

dashae

Цитата: LexaK от 11 мая 2020, 16:01
просто в свой запрос добавьте еще одну колонку Месяц
так, пример

Выбрать
    ...
    ВашРегистр.ДатаПроведения,
    НАЧАЛОПЕРИОДА(ВашРегистр.ДатаПроведения, Месяц) как Месяц,
    ...

к вашим полям
"Площадка", "ДатаПроведения" и ресурс "ОбъемПробы".
и группировки по строкам делаете по месяцу
Строки
    Месяц
        ДетальныеЗаписи
в детальных записях
    "ДатаПроведения" и ресурс "ОбъемПробы".

да и сортировку по "ДатаПроведения" включите обязательно
(возможно оптимальнее сделать вертикальное расположение групп вместо горизонтальной (как на примере)
оформите ваш отчет как внешний, присоедините  к теме, будет гораздо легче давть советы/примеры

В отчете "График отбора проб" шапка раскрывается вправо, а надо вниз. Такое возможно сделать? (Например, А(распред сеть) под ним корп(хол))
В отчете "План отбора проб" дублируется название месяца каждой датой.
И в этих двух отчетах нет никакой реакции на изменение параметров. Пока не разобралась почему. Подскажите, пожалуйста.

LexaK

ЦитироватьИ в этих двух отчетах нет никакой реакции на изменение параметров. Пока не разобралась почему. Подскажите, пожалуйста.
Отчеты с СКД, после их формирования, запоминают все настройки пользователя, в том числе структуру/состав полей, порядок группировок, значения параметров и т.д.
После того как вы изменили/доработали отчет в конфигураторе, необходимо сбросить старые настройки пользователя!
Делается это так, в режиме Предприятия запускаете ваш измененный отчет, нажимаете кнопку: Изменить вариант, где-то там есть команда Стандартные настройки!
Выполните ее! Применятся все ваши новые доработки. Внимание! при этом будут сброшены все значения параметров и отборов, их надо будет задавать по новому.


без конфы конечно непонятно как править отчет, но вот что-то получилось,
попробуйте как есть запустить.
если помогло нажмите: Спасибо!

dashae

Цитата: LexaK от 13 мая 2020, 13:02
ЦитироватьИ в этих двух отчетах нет никакой реакции на изменение параметров. Пока не разобралась почему. Подскажите, пожалуйста.
Отчеты с СКД, после их формирования, запоминают все настройки пользователя, в том числе структуру/состав полей, порядок группировок, значения параметров и т.д.
После того как вы изменили/доработали отчет в конфигураторе, необходимо сбросить старые настройки пользователя!
Делается это так, в режиме Предприятия запускаете ваш измененный отчет, нажимаете кнопку: Изменить вариант, где-то там есть команда Стандартные настройки!
Выполните ее! Применятся все ваши новые доработки. Внимание! при этом будут сброшены все значения параметров и отборов, их надо будет задавать по новому.


без конфы конечно непонятно как править отчет, но вот что-то получилось,
попробуйте как есть запустить.

ох, спасибо вам огромнейшее!))
я его еще немного подредактировала, и все получилось)
Добавлено: 15 мая 2020, 23:53


Цитата: LexaK от 13 мая 2020, 13:02
ЦитироватьИ в этих двух отчетах нет никакой реакции на изменение параметров. Пока не разобралась почему. Подскажите, пожалуйста.
Отчеты с СКД, после их формирования, запоминают все настройки пользователя, в том числе структуру/состав полей, порядок группировок, значения параметров и т.д.
После того как вы изменили/доработали отчет в конфигураторе, необходимо сбросить старые настройки пользователя!
Делается это так, в режиме Предприятия запускаете ваш измененный отчет, нажимаете кнопку: Изменить вариант, где-то там есть команда Стандартные настройки!
Выполните ее! Применятся все ваши новые доработки. Внимание! при этом будут сброшены все значения параметров и отборов, их надо будет задавать по новому.


без конфы конечно непонятно как править отчет, но вот что-то получилось,
попробуйте как есть запустить.

а не подскажете, как сделать сравнение плана и факта? Получается данные в них одинаковые, берутся из двух регистров(ПланОтбора и ФактОтбора). Я хотела бы сравнивать даты, то есть совпадают ли ДатаПлан и ДатаФакт.

И существует ли такая возможность добавить поле с типом булево в сам отчет? Например, если даты по строке совпали, то для этой строки ставилась бы галочка, о том, что ДатаФакт = ДатаПлан.

Пока есть вот такие два макета. Как правильнее сделать план-фактный отчет не представляю(
Помогите, пожалуйста.
Добавлено: 16 мая 2020, 20:41


Цитата: LexaK от 13 мая 2020, 13:02
ЦитироватьИ в этих двух отчетах нет никакой реакции на изменение параметров. Пока не разобралась почему. Подскажите, пожалуйста.
Отчеты с СКД, после их формирования, запоминают все настройки пользователя, в том числе структуру/состав полей, порядок группировок, значения параметров и т.д.
После того как вы изменили/доработали отчет в конфигураторе, необходимо сбросить старые настройки пользователя!
Делается это так, в режиме Предприятия запускаете ваш измененный отчет, нажимаете кнопку: Изменить вариант, где-то там есть команда Стандартные настройки!
Выполните ее! Применятся все ваши новые доработки. Внимание! при этом будут сброшены все значения параметров и отборов, их надо будет задавать по новому.


без конфы конечно непонятно как править отчет, но вот что-то получилось,
попробуйте как есть запустить.

пока есть только такая версия сопоставления плана и факта. Но с датами проблема - даты не соответствуют месяцам.

LexaK

посмотрите этот отчет, между План-Факт сделано сравнение по ДатаПроведения, Площадка и ВидОтбораПроб (по идее по всем Измерениям надо вопрягать) (следующий раз структуру регистров выложите)
добавлена колонка: СовпадениеПланФакт - Истина/Ложь
если помогло нажмите: Спасибо!

dashae

Цитата: LexaK от 18 мая 2020, 17:10
посмотрите этот отчет, между План-Факт сделано сравнение по ДатаПроведения, Площадка и ВидОтбораПроб (по идее по всем Измерениям надо вопрягать) (следующий раз структуру регистров выложите)
добавлена колонка: СовпадениеПланФакт - Истина/Ложь
Отчет посмотрела, спасибо большое) Правда получился он очень объемным :)) (скрин ниже).
Мне по сути надо сравнивать только даты, а объемы проб не нужны. При совпадении плана и факта выходит только Да.
И еще не подскажете, как добавить наименование месяца? Чтобы слева выходило наименование месяца, а под ним шли даты, соответствующие этому месяцу.
Также ниже прикрепляю структуру регистров)

LexaK

dashae, как вы хотите только по одним ДатамПроведения сравнивать? Посмотрите сколько у ва измерений!
если у вас в плане на одну Дата было 2-3 Площадки, а по факту на эту-же дату 14 измерений по разным площадкам (видам,точка,измерениям,ответственным, и т.д.)
то эти План и Факт по вашему равны?
если помогло нажмите: Спасибо!

Теги:

Похожие темы (5)

Рейтинг@Mail.ru

Поиск